$S&P/ASX 200 (.XJO.AU)$ended 0.6% lower at 7029.2 amid broad-based losses, led by the materials and energy sectors.
Almost all sectors finished in the red, with only telecom services and property trusts closing in positive territory.
Wealth manager$AMP Ltd (AMP.AU)$was the day's best-performing stock, rising 5.9% after announcing that it had settled its buyer of last resort class action proceedings.
$Origin Energy Ltd (ORG.AU)$fell 1.1%, after the Australian power company postponed its shareholder vote on a potential takeover on receipt of a revised proposal.
